Education
Div Academy ( 2025 / Present )
Backend Development
Developing backend applications with Node.js, Express.js, and NestJS, focusing on RESTful APIs, authentication, validation, error handling, database integration, and testing.
- Node JS
- Express JS
- Nest JS
- TypeScript
- REST DESIGN
- Validation
- PostgreSQL
- TypeORM
- Error Handling
- Testing
Div Academy ( 2024 / 8 months )
Frontend Development
Learned to build modern, responsive, and interactive websites using core web technologies and libraries. Developed full-featured projects and improved UX/UI design thinking.
- HTML5
- CSS3
- JavaScript (ES6+)
- React.js
- Redux Toolkit
- Tailwind CSS
- Bootstrap
- jQuery
- REST API Integration
Azerbaijan Technical University ( 2005 – 2009 )
Economics and Management of Manufacturing and Service Industries
Gained analytical thinking and problem-solving skills, management principles, and industrial system planning background. Built strong foundation in process optimization and production systems.
Frontend Technologies
Backend Technologies
Tools
About Me
My name is Aghasalim Musayev
I am a Frontend Developer with backend experience, creating modern, responsive, and user-friendly web applications. My focus is on clean code, performance optimization, and delivering smooth user experiences.
Skilled with HTML5, CSS3 (Flexbox, Grid), JavaScript (ES6+), React.js, Redux Toolkit, RESTful APIs, jQuery, Bootstrap, Tailwind CSS and modern development workflows. I have strong knowledge of building responsive and cross-browser compatible layouts, applying best practices in UI/UX design, performance optimization and ensuring accessibility.
I can design and develop scalable, reusable components with React, manage application state efficiently with Redux Toolkit, and integrate APIs with Axios or Fetch. I am experienced in responsive design principles, creating adaptive interfaces for mobile and desktop, and customizing frameworks like Bootstrap and Tailwind for unique designs.
On the backend, I build RESTful APIs using Node.js, Express.js, and NestJS, implementing JWT-based authentication, authorization, request validation with Zod, centralized error handling, and API testing with Jest. I work with PostgreSQL as the relational database, using TypeORM for data modeling and persistence. And also use Docker to create consistent and portable development environments.
I work comfortably with GitHub for version control systems, package managers (NPM/Yarn), and tools such as Postman, VS Code, and Figma to ensure efficient and maintainable development workflows. With strong analytical thinking, I quickly understand problem domains and turn ideas into reliable, high-quality, end-to-end solutions.